Gentle ways for movement to help with grief:β―Β β―
Go for a short, daily walk in natureβ―Β
Try gentle yoga, pilates,
Tend to a garden
β―
You donβt have to run a marathon. Sometimes, the most powerful act of self-care is simply standing up, stepping outside and allowing your body to lead the way forward

Richmond Council logo and graphic of a person coloured orange on the left with symbols indicating dizziness, sweating, pain and a glass of water, and red on the right with symbols for confusion, heart and heat waves. Heading reads 'Symptoms of Exhaustion and Heatstroke'. Text on yellow left side reads 'Heat Exhaustion - tiredness, weakness, feeling faint, headache, muscle cramps, feeling or being sick, heavy sweating, intense thirst. Text on red right side reads 'Heat stroke - confusion, lack of coordination, fast heartbeat, fast breathing or shortness of breath, hot skin that is not sweating, seizures. Act fast - Get help. Call NHS 111 or in an emergency 999.
